File tree Expand file tree Collapse file tree 1 file changed +0
-22
lines changed
plugwise_usb/nodes/helpers Expand file tree Collapse file tree 1 file changed +0
-22
lines changed Original file line number Diff line number Diff line change @@ -277,28 +277,6 @@ def update_pulse_counter(
277277 self ._pulses_consumption = pulses_consumed
278278 self ._pulses_production = pulses_produced
279279
280- def update_pulse_counter (
281- self , pulses_consumed : int , pulses_produced : int , timestamp : datetime
282- ) -> None :
283- """Update pulse counter."""
284- self ._pulses_timestamp = timestamp
285- self ._update_rollover ()
286- if not (self ._rollover_consumption or self ._rollover_production ):
287- # No rollover based on time, check rollover based on counter reset
288- # Required for special cases like nodes which have been power off for several days
289- if (
290- self ._pulses_consumption is not None
291- and self ._pulses_consumption > pulses_consumed
292- ):
293- self ._rollover_consumption = True
294- if (
295- self ._pulses_production is not None
296- and self ._pulses_production > pulses_produced
297- ):
298- self ._rollover_production = True
299- self ._pulses_consumption = pulses_consumed
300- self ._pulses_production = pulses_produced
301-
302280 ######### still to finish
303281 def _update_rollover (self ) -> None :
304282 """Update rollover states. Returns True if rollover is applicable."""
You can’t perform that action at this time.
0 commit comments